If you like mysteries you might like the book "Miss Nelson is Missing", by James Marshall. Miss Nelson has a hard time teaching her students. Her students misbehave. When she comes back after being absent they are nice to her because Miss Swamp, the substitute, had been mean to them. Miss Swamp made them do all the work. Do you know who Miss Swamp really is? The kids in room 207 think she's a witch. Can you solve this story?
